DISCUZ X
最新 热门 评论 右侧模板
再整理,再出发,人生是一段不休的自我救赎……
Discuz! X3.4后台操作保存之后出现报错
UCenter info: MySQL Query Error
SQL:SELECT * FROM [Table]notelist WHERE closed='0' AND app1<'1' AND app1>'-5' LIMIT 1
Error:Unknown column 'app1' in 'where clause'
Errno:1054
解决方案
把应用里边的UC设置信息,类似如下的,复制覆盖config/config_ucenter.php里边的全部信息,多个的话,放在相应的位置就好了
define(‘UC_CONNECT’, ‘mysql’);
define(‘UC_DBHOST’, ‘localhost’);
define(‘UC_DBUSER’, ‘‘);
define(‘UC_DBPW’, ‘‘);
define(‘UC_DBNAME’, ‘‘);
define(‘UC_DBCHARSET’, ‘gbk’);
define(‘UC_DBTABLEPRE’, ‘************
.pre_ucenter_’);
define(‘UC_DBCONNECT’, ‘0’);
define(‘UC_KEY’, ‘+/+ntS9kktappaFLNcdctby8QzDuvYdN1CO/‘);
define(‘UC_API’, ‘http://www..com/uc_server’);
define(‘UC_CHARSET’, ‘gbk’);
define(‘UC_IP’, ”);
define(‘UC_APPID’, ‘1’);
define(‘UC_PPP’, ’20’);
本人成功解决
说是discuz x3.4,应该X3基本通用:
一、备份网站数据。
进入后台—站长—数据库—备份,备份成功以后,数据保存在 data/backup_210218_TEt4yz(类似这样的文件名,你的后面部分肯定不一样)。
二、备份网站文件。
有些朋友说下载一个新的discuz X3.4安装,再把网站改过的文件去覆盖,还列举了哪些文件是可能改过的,我觉得这样容易出错,而且很麻烦,所以我的建议是,把自己的整个网站打包下载下来,这样不会差错,很好用。(本人经过很多坑,当然高手的话,那就另外说)
三、网站文件包处理。注意,把你网站里的下面这些文件删除:
/config/config_global.php
/config/config_ucenter.php
/uc_server/data/config.inc.php
/install/install.lock(删除install文件夹下面的全部文件)
放心的删掉这几个文件,重新安装就有新的了。
重新安装还需要安装程序,所以再到官方下载一个discuz x3 的安装包,把里面的\upload\install\index.php复制到你的网站文件install\下!
还需要数据库还原程序,把下载的新安装包里面的utility\restore.php文件放到你网站文件的/data/文件夹内。
四、将处理好的网站包上传到新空间。
打包上传后再解压,快很多啊。虚拟主机一般是上传到db文件夹内,到虚拟主机商后台解压到web目录,再把文件移到根目录,同样快很多。
五、安装。
进你的域名安装吧。注意数据库的数据表前缀和以前一样。
六、安装成功以后,到—站长—数据库—还原数据。
注意这里你可能遇到一个问题,恢复里面没有数据,别担心,用ftp查看data文件下,是不是有两个backup_d1d32c类似这样的文件,其中一个内有你的备份数据,就把备份文件移到另一个里面就可以了。
还原以后,后台账号退出,用你原来的后台账号登陆吧,更新一下缓存。就搬家完毕了。
注意:搬家过程中,请关闭论坛。尤其是数据备份和还原时请不要操作论坛。
全新安装教程
升级说明
X3.4 自身升级
从 X3.2、X3.3 升级
https://discuz.com/docs/install_bt_linux.html
安装完宝塔并登录宝塔
进入PHP的设置,选择安装扩展,安装fileinfo和exif两个扩展,选择禁用函数,删除putenv, readlink, symlink
进入宝塔『文件』,点击进入刚创建的网站主目录,点击远程下载,在URL处输入 https://dl.discuz.chat/dzq_latest_install.zip,并点击确定。然后,等待下载完成后,将文件解压缩到网站的根目录。
修改网站配置
进入『网站目录』,将运行目录修改为/public,点击保存。如果使用Apache,无需其它配置;如果使用Nginx,请点击『伪静态』,将以下内容复制粘贴进去,并点击保存
location / {
try_files $uri $uri/ /index.php?$query_string;
}
gzip on;
gzip_min_length 1024;
gzip_types text/css application/x-javascript application/vnd.api+json;
gzip_disable “MSIE [1-6].”;
gzip_comp_level 2;
最便捷的是下载Xshell,然后登陆root账户安装。
Ubuntu/Deepin安装命令:
wget -O install.sh http://download.bt.cn/install/install-ubuntu_6.0.sh && sudo bash install.sh
Debian安装命令:
wget -O install.sh http://download.bt.cn/install/install-ubuntu_6.0.sh && bash install.sh
Fedora安装命令:
wget -O install.sh http://download.bt.cn/install/install_6.0.sh && bash install.sh
Linux面板7.3.0升级命令:
curl http://download.bt.cn/install/update6.sh|bash
以上节点无法使用的情况下,请使用下面的备用节点:
备用节点【广东】:
yum install -y wget && wget -O install.sh http://125.88.182.172:5880/install/install_6.0.sh && sh install.sh
备用节点【香港】:
yum install -y wget && wget -O install.sh http://103.224.251.67:5880/install/install_6.0.sh && sh install.sh
备用节点【美国】:
yum install -y wget && wget -O install.sh http://128.1.164.196:5880/install/install_6.0.sh && sh install.sh
若点击更新后没生效,请尝试重启面板服务:
bt restart
例如Chrome添加谷歌上网助手时,出现已使用本地化功能,但未在清单中指定 default_local, 无法加载清单。
打开链接:http://googlehelper.net/ 重新下载新的插件,重新加载最新的插件即可。
利用搜狗输入法,输入拼音xuanzhong即可。
将光标放在文档中,之后点击插入——符号——其他符号,在打开的界面中找到即可。
在文档中输入大写R,然后点击开始——字体,将字体的内容更改为“Windings2”即可。
将光标定位在文档中,点击开始——字体——带圈字符,在打开的界面中选择增大圈号,在字体中输入√,然后选中方框的圈号样式即可。
在文档中输入√,之后选中文本,点击开始——字体——字符边框。
点击开发工具——控件——复选框,插入之后点击属性,找到复选框属性,点击“选中复选框”中的更改,打开相应的对话框,点击即可。
Win7下用EasyBCD引导Linux双系统启动工具
EasyBCD
默认: Windows 7
超时: 跳过
引导驱动器: C:\
条目 #1
名称: Windows 7
BCD ID: {current}
驱动器: C:\
Bootloader的路径: \Windows\system32\winload.exe